This isn’t a difficult dish to make if you follow my instructions, especially about removing the pan from the heat and letting it cool a little before adding the eggs to the pasta. If the pan is too hot, the eggs will scramble instead of creating that silky smooth sauce. This makes for a great dinner on busy nights, since it takes less than 15 minutes to make and uses simple ingredients you may already have on hand. It also features bacon, and you can never go wrong with bacon! If you want to add some vegetables, a simple side salad would be a great accompaniment.

Can Spaghetti Carbonara be reheated?

Carbonara is best made and served immediately as the sauce will absorb into the pasta and is tastiest when fresh. Leftovers can be refrigerated for up to 3 days.

When do you add egg to spaghetti carbonara?

This recipe calls for the egg mixture to be added at the last step, once the heat has been turned off completely.

Can you make Spaghetti Carbonara ahead of time?

Spaghetti Carbonara is best made and served immediately.
